The U.S. approves the sale of M109A6 Paladin SPH to Taiwan


The US State Department has approved the sale of 40 155mm M109A6 Paladin self-propelled howitzers (SPH) and 20 M992A2 Field Artillery Ammunition Support Vehicles (FAASV) to Taiwan, as well as the potential foreign military sales (FMS) of related equipment and technical support.

The US Defense Security Cooperation Agency (DSCA) announced on August 4 that the US-based Taipei Economic and Cultural Representative Office (TECRO) also requested 5 M88A2 Hercules Armored Recovery Vehicles (ARV) and 1,698 sets of precision guidance kits.

The proposed transaction still needs to be approved by the U.S. Congress and is worth up to 750 million U.S. dollars.

In addition to vehicles and guidance kits, TECRO also requested a series of mission equipment, including BAE System Defense Advanced Global Positioning System Receiver (DAGR); AN/VVS(2) Night Driver’s Viewer (NDV) equipment; L3Harris dynamic reference unit hybrid replacement Inertial navigation system; and Raytheon’s Advanced Field Artillery Tactical Data System (AFATDS).

Other items included in the TECRO request include the export of single-channel ground and airborne radio systems (SINCGARS), M2A1 12.7 mm heavy machine guns, weapon mounts, smoke grenade launchers, and artillery.

The M109A6 SPH is a modernized version of the M109A2 platform currently used by the Republic of China Army (RoCA). It can use the latest generation of ammunition, increase the ammunition load, and improve the survivability of vehicles and occupants. It also reduces the need for four crew members instead of six.

The FMS approval was the first to be granted to Taiwan. Under the management of US President Joe Biden, Taiwan is increasingly threatened by a confident Chinese invasion—China believes that Taiwan is a country that must be unified with the mainland. Separate provinces.

Rupert Hammond-Chambers, chairman of the U.S.-Taiwan Business Council, said: “We expect that the United States will continue to conduct arms sales on a regular, timely and regular basis to promote Taiwan’s military preparations.”

Hammond Chambers added: “We also hope to see the Biden administration provide Taiwan with more new capabilities to help expand its current military posture and continue to improve its multi-level self-defense capabilities.”

The high-profile FMS approval granted to Taiwan earlier last year includes potential sales of the potentially weaponized GA-ASI MQ-9B SeaGuardian long-endurance drone, the Boeing Harpoon Coastal Defense System, and the RGM-84L-4 Harpoon Block II. Ship missile and M142 HIMARS launcher.
